Summary/Abstract: Josip Križan (1841-1921) was professor at the Varaždin secondary school during the period of the Austro-Hungarian Monarchy. He was an excellent teacher and he also gave a great contribution to the development of scientific and cultural activities in Varaždin. He graduated in Graz, where he lated gained doctoral degree. First he worked in Požega secondary school and then he moved to Varaždin where he lived until his retirement in 1903. In Varaždin he organized numerous public lectures and he also took part in founding and activities of the Croatian singing-club "Vila" and he was member of various other cultural societies. He also wrote numerous scientific and popular articles.
